Private Beach Location
Nestled on a private beach just a stone's throw away from Host Dolphin Tours, Barefoot Beach Hotel offers a serene escape with a heated outdoor pool showcasing breathtaking views of the Gulf of Mexico.
Cozy Studios with Spectacular Views
Each studio at Barefoot Beach Hotel boasts a warm ambiance with either ocean or pool views, complemented by modern amenities like free WiFi, flat-screen cable TV, and a convenient kitchenette.
Convenient Amenities and Services
Guests can take advantage of complimentary scooter rental delivery, indulge in a casual barbecue, and explore the vibrant John’s Pass entertainment area just a short stroll away.

Good size room with a balcony overlooking the excellent beach directly below. Facing west it was ideally located for those great sunsets. Very comfortable and good parking (chargeable) at the hotel. No food facilities at the hotel but numerous different restaurants within easy walking distance.
Could be noisy at times depending on other guests. The sound insulation between rooms wasn't great and with tiled flooring any movement of chairs or heavy shoes from the room above could be easily heard.
Bathroom was very clean but really rather dated and showing it's age.

We found the Barefoot Beach Club via TripAdvisor's great reviews & made the long drive over from Delray Beach, so we didn't arrive until after dark. It did NOT disappoint & we WILL be back to stay longer next time!
The staff was very friendly, both on the phone when I called mid-drive for reservations, & in person when we arrived, plus in the morning when we were leaving. The beach has fine white sand & was very clean, too. The rubber wristbands with your electronic hotel key embedded in it worked great & is one less thing to keep track of when you're on the beach (or stumbling back drunk from the bars nearby, if that's your jam).
The king studio #402 overlooking the pool was way bigger than I expected & although it did not have a dedicated bedroom door to close for privacy, the half wall divider between it & the living room area blocked off enough sound/light so I could sleep while my husband watched tv into the wee hours.
From the balcony we could partially see the beach in the morning & since we arrived so late at night, paying extra for a room facing the ocean wasn't a priority for our 1 night stay. We'd probably do it tho when we stay longer next time because we definitely will return!
A few blocks away (just a short walk) is the John's Pass Village & Boardwalk, which would be so much fun to do by day, however most every restaurant & shop was closed because we arrived later at night. We did eat at the Pirates Pub-N-Grub & the shrimp tacos were good.
Next time we want to try The Friendly Fisherman restaurant because it came highly recommended by the hotel staff, but it was closed by the time we got there. There's a Waffle House a short drive away which is where we ate breakfast on our way out of town because you can't go wrong with the WH breakfasts & they're still affordable, too.
